Italy putting nearly all major cities on highest heat alert

Italy is placing nearly all of its major cities on the highest heat alert due to a strengthening subtropical anticyclone from North Africa. Nineteen major cities, including Rome, Milan, and Naples, are already on red alert, with all but two expected to be by Monday.

Full report

1 min read · 193 words
The extreme heat is being caused by a subtropical anticyclone from North Africa that is now strengthening over the Mediterranean.Meanwhile, firefighters in Greece, France, Portugal and Spain are still tackling blazes spanning thousands of hectares.In France, some 2,500 people were evacuated in the south-eastern Var region on Friday evening after a blaze - which had been contained for several days - reignited, local officials said.But a massive fire in the south-western Gironde region is now under control, and some 200,000 local evacuated residents have been able to return to their homes.In Greece, hundreds of people - mostly tourists - have been evacuated by sea from a coastal town of Viotia hemmed in by one of the many wildfires raging across the country.And in Spain, more than 200,000 hectares of land has burnt in 2026 - roughly five times above the average by this point in the year - while the burnt land in Portugal is also higher than usual, EU data shows.Climate Change is driving up temperatures around the world, and Europe is the fastest warming continent, heating up twice as fast as the global average, according to the Copernicus Climate Change Service.
